Objectives:

Upon completion, the trainee will be better able to:
  • Identify the accounting cycle and prepare journal entries and trial balances.
  • Analyze the four basic financial statements and interpret their indicators.
  • Calculate and interpret key financial ratios (liquidity, leverage, activity, and profitability).
  • Prepare operating and financial budgets and understand their various methodologies.
  • Apply cost management concepts, analyze variances, and support managerial decisions.
  • Become familiar with professional ethics as outlined in the Institute of Management Accountants and the Fraud Triangle.

Trainer:

Firas Abu Qtaish

Firas Abu Qteish joined Ritaj’s Team in 2015. As a certified professional and a financial manager, Firas has a wealth of experience in training groups on specific financial topics ranging between analysis and certification.

Prior to stepping into the training field, Firas has chosen to build and strengthen his knowledge in particular areas such as budget policies, compliance, compliance, reviewing and interpreting accounting and financial management policies, procedures, standards and statutes.

With his current position as Head of Risk management at Palestine Investment Bank Holding and a previous position at the AB Invest-?the investment arm for Arab Bank Palestine, Firas has influenced his training approach by linking theory with practice using actual case studies from the Palestinian economy and relating it to the international standards of professional certification. He has both the CMA & CIA, CRMA credentials in addition to the CFA.
